The spectra of high-energy protons and nuclei accelerated by supernova
remnant shocks are calculated taking into account magnetic field amplification
and Alfvenic drift for different types of SNRs during their evolution. The
overall energy spectrum and elemental composition of cosmic rays after
propagation through the Galaxy are found.
